Understanding the PSI Real Estate Exam

Before diving into preparation strategies‚ it’s important to understand the structure and content of the PSI Real Estate Exam. The exam typically consists of two main sections:

  • National Component: This section covers fundamental real estate principles and practices applicable across the United States.
  • State-Specific Component: This part focuses on real estate laws and regulations specific to your state.

Exam Format

The PSI Real Estate Exam is computer-based and consists of multiple-choice questions. Candidates are usually given a set amount of time to complete the exam‚ and it is important to manage this time effectively.

Understanding Core Concepts

Familiarize yourself with the core concepts that are frequently tested on the exam:

  • Real Estate Principles: Understand the basic principles of real estate‚ including property ownership‚ rights‚ and the various types of real estate.
  • Real Estate Laws: Learn about federal and state laws that govern real estate transactions‚ including fair housing laws and agency relationships.
  • Contracts: Grasp the essentials of contracts‚ including contract formation‚ performance‚ and breach.
  • Financing: Study various financing methods‚ loan types‚ and the mortgage process.
  • Property Management: Understand the roles and responsibilities of property managers and the basics of property maintenance.
